From 20ad2d05dff98c3a7dd313646036784c1a044343 Mon Sep 17 00:00:00 2001 From: Andreas Dilger Date: Wed, 30 Aug 2017 01:56:08 -0400 Subject: [PATCH] tune2fs: quiet llvm build warning Quiet a relatively harmless build warning: tune2fs.c:928:18: warning: '&&' within '||' [-Wlogical-op-parentheses] if (pass == 1 && (inode->i_flags & EXT4_EA_INODE_FL) || ~~~~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 ~~ tune2fs.c:928:18: place parentheses around '&&' to silence warning Signed-off-by: Andreas Dilger Signed-off-by: Theodore Ts'o --- misc/tune2fs.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/misc/tune2fs.c b/misc/tune2fs.c index 18cea52..ecba2ea 100644 --- a/misc/tune2fs.c +++ b/misc/tune2fs.c @@ -929,8 +929,10 @@ static void rewrite_inodes(ext2_filsys fs) if (!ino) break; - if (pass == 1 && (inode->i_flags & EXT4_EA_INODE_FL) || - pass == 2 && !(inode->i_flags & EXT4_EA_INODE_FL)) + if (((pass == 1) && + (inode->i_flags & EXT4_EA_INODE_FL)) || + ((pass == 2) && + !(inode->i_flags & EXT4_EA_INODE_FL))) rewrite_one_inode(&ctx, ino, inode); } while (ino); -- 1.8.3.1